Meditation, Stage 1: Gathering the light

But when the practice is started, one must press on from the obvious to the profound, from the coarse to the fine. Everything depends on there being no interruption. The beginning and the end of the practice must be one. In between there are cooler and warmer moments, that goes without saying. But the goal must be to reach the vastness of heaven and the depths of the sea, so that all methods seem quite easy and taken for granted. Only then have we mastered it.
 All holy men have bequeathed this to one another: nothing is possible without contemplation (fan-chao, reflection). When Confucius says: ‘Perceiving brings one to the goal’; or when the Buddha calls it: ‘The vision of the heart’; or Lao-tse says: ‘Inner vision’, it is all the same.
